Subject: Timetable solver release — Bellmark 3.1

All,

Bellmark 3.1 is out. The solver now handles split-shift teacher constraints and room capacity overrides without the manual pre-pass. Maintainers should note the constraint weights moved from code into the schedules config file; future tuning happens there, not in the solver core. Regression suite passes on all district fixtures. The shipped build is identified by the token below.

session token of fahap-hawip = htk31_7852f2b3276dba2738f98fa97f92237

## Deployment

So you've built a plugin for Crumbline's order-cutoff engine — nice. Deploying is straightforward, with one gotcha: the cutoff rule (orders in by 2pm bake next morning) is enforced server-side, not in your plugin. Don't try to re-implement it; you'll just fight the scheduler. Bundle your plugin, push it to the staging shelf, and run the smoke bake. If orders slip past cutoff in staging, your clock offsets are wrong. Staging runs with the following configuration values.

deployment values, kajep-kageg:
[praix]
host = praix.paliqcorp.corp
user = praix_svc
database = praix_prod

# Gross-Margin Review — Managers Only

Margins at Tessmark Goods slipped 2.1 points this quarter. Drivers: freight surcharges on the Aldine route, discounting on the Corvale line, and rework at the Penbrook plant. Pricing corrections go live next month. Branch managers should hold promotional spend until then. Context on where this fits the broader plan follows below.

board note of kageg-bahof: The renewal with Holwynax Holdings closes at $2 million a year, 5 percent below the last contract. Project Ulaath slips by two quarters because of the supplier delay.